This is a scam and a very well know one. There is no investment, no withdrawal , consider the money you sent this person as gone.

If they haven't already, this person will go dark and block you on all social media accounts and start the scam again under a new name. Better make peace with this fact now. That's an expensive lesson to learn but now you know.

There is literally 0% chance that you will see your money again.

And how should I react if there's competition? Even big competition in the niche I'm focusing?
Competition is not a bad thing. It means someone is paying for that service. At least a sound and proven market.

If you could find areas to improve on and provide a differentiation and skewness in value it is a potential good business. If not then otherwise.

90 percent of decent business ideas are just finding out what customers are paying for right now and make signifincant improvement in certain areas to take a piece of the pie.
